Transaction 3cf5005606e71482bf455a36ffe17b3e2541a386e78176093ebd5a74ce043ac9
1 Input
1 Output
-
3cf5005606e71482bf455a36ffe17b3e2541a386e78176093ebd5a74ce043ac9:0
- value
- 500095
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a827cd7c3c3ddf1f296148cb23c17e741660923 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19Fa8hzhg1mrExro68tzpL14L1wpdV3fKT